Roofing needs vary across regions due to differences in climate, humidity, and weather conditions. Homes in southern areas face unique environmental challenges that influence how roofs are designed, built, and maintained. Understanding these variations helps property owners make informed choices about materials and maintenance practices.
Climate and Weather Differences
The southern climate brings long periods of heat, humidity, and frequent storms. Materials exposed to these elements must withstand high temperatures and heavy rainfall. In contrast, northern regions experience cold winters and snowfall, demanding roofs that resist ice accumulation and freezing conditions.
Because of this contrast, a roof that performs well in one region may not be suitable in another. Local weather patterns directly influence how roofing systems age, expand, and resist moisture damage.
Material Selection for Southern Conditions
Heat resistance and moisture protection are top priorities for homeowners in warm, humid areas. Roofing materials must reflect sunlight effectively and resist mold growth caused by persistent humidity. Metal panels, reflective shingles, and specialized coatings are often preferred because they perform better in these conditions.
In northern states, materials like asphalt shingles and slate are common due to their ability to handle heavy snow and low temperatures. However, these may not offer the same efficiency in hotter climates where thermal expansion can cause cracking or warping.
Impact of Storms and Rainfall
Frequent thunderstorms and heavy rainfall can cause leaks and structural issues. Proper drainage design and timely inspections are essential to prevent water intrusion. Durability under high wind pressure is also critical. Roof fasteners, sealants, and underlayment systems must meet local building codes that account for tropical storm conditions. These requirements differ significantly from those in colder climates where wind speeds may be lower but snow loads are higher.
Energy Efficiency and Ventilation
Hot climates demand roofing systems that help maintain cooler indoor temperatures. Proper roof ventilation prevents heat buildup in attics and reduces strain on air conditioning systems. Reflective surfaces can also lower energy costs by minimizing heat absorption during peak summer months.
In northern areas, insulation takes priority to retain warmth and prevent ice dams. The balance between ventilation and insulation changes depending on regional needs, demonstrating why uniform standards cannot apply nationwide.
Maintenance and Longevity
Routine maintenance ensures long-term roof performance regardless of location. However, southern homeowners must pay special attention to algae growth, UV exposure, and moisture damage. Regular cleaning and inspection prevent costly repairs later.

Regional Standards and Building Codes
Building codes reflect each region’s environmental risks. In the South, they emphasize wind resistance and water protection, while northern codes focus on snow load requirements and insulation standards. Adhering to these regulations ensures safety and compliance with local conditions.
